当你遇到 pd.read_excel 报错时,可以按照以下步骤进行排查和解决: 确认具体的报错信息: 报错信息通常包含了问题的关键线索。例如,可能是关于文件路径的错误、库未安装的错误、文件格式不支持的错误等。请仔细查看报错信息,并尝试理解其含义。 检查Python环境: 确保你的Python环境中已经安装了pandas库
"E:\Python\lib\site-packages\xlrd\compdoc.py",line426CompDocError("%s corruption: seen[%d] == %d"%(qname.CompDocError:Workbook corruption:seen[2]==4 由于在电脑上直接打开excel,excel是正常的。 继续看报错信息,来自于源文件compdoc.py,打开该文件,找到426行代码,代码如下: 代码语言:javascript 代...
代码语言:txt 复制 import pandas as pd excel_file = pd.ExcelFile('path/to/your/file.xlsx') df = pd.read_excel(excel_file, sheet_name='Sheet1') 将Excel文件复制到另一个位置,然后尝试读取复制后的文件。有时候文件所在的路径或文件本身可能存在权限问题...
in <module> main() File "C:\Users\Public\workspace\a.py", line 47, in main blend = plStream(rootDir); File "C:\Users\Public\workspace\a.py", line 20, in plStream df = pd.read_excel(fPath, sheetname="linear strategy", index_col="date", parse_dates=True) File "C:\Users\Pub...
df = pd.read_excel(path)df = df.where(df.notnull(), None) #这句的作用是把表格里的NAN替换掉,这里的None,可以换成你想替换的东西 需要安装xlrd:pip install xlrd 1. 使用pandas库:pandas库是一个流行的Python数据分析库,它可以读取包含图表的Excel文件,并将其转换为DataFrame对象。您可以使用以下代码读...
df=pd.read_excel('example.xlsx')print(df) 1. 2. 3. 4. 5. # 使用 OpenPyXL 读取 Excel (能够读取隐藏行)fromopenpyxlimportload_workbook workbook=load_workbook('example.xlsx',data_only=True)sheet=workbook.activeforrowinsheet.iter_rows(values_only=True):print(row) ...
尝试读其他文件夹的文件是否正常,如果可以,一般就是文件读写权限的问题。
首先,认识一下pd.read_excel(),函数的官方文档是这么说的:将Excel文件读取到pandas DataFrame中,支持本地文件系统或URL的’xls’和’xlsx’文件扩展名,带有这两种扩展名的文件,函数都可以处理;然后它的函数完整版长这个样子:没想到吧,它它它…它居然有二十多个参数,是不是有点出乎意料,接下来认识下这些...
(nrows, ncols)).value df = pd.DataFrame(v[1:], columns=v[0]) df.to_csv('./1.csv', index=False, encoding='utf_8_sig') df = df.infer_objects() print(df.dtypes) xls.close() app.quit() 2.先把excel转为csv,再读取csv https://devpress.csdn.net/python/630450f8c67703293080af08...